AAIB Begins Probe Into Air India Crash in Ahmedabad; Tata Group Announces Support

Published on

The Aircraft Accident Investigation Bureau (AAIB) has launched an official investigation into the recent Air India crash in Ahmedabad that killed 241 people. The government has assured that the inquiry will adhere to global aviation safety standards.

AAIB to Conduct Probe as per International Guidelines

Civil Aviation Minister Ram Mohan Naidu stated that the AAIB’s investigation will follow protocols established by the International Civil Aviation Organisation (ICAO). A high-level committee of multidisciplinary experts is being formed to thoroughly examine the incident and recommend safety improvements to prevent future aviation mishaps.

Tata Group Announces Ex-Gratia and Medical Support

In a compassionate gesture, Tata Group Chairman N Chandrasekaran announced financial aid of ₹1 crore for the families of each deceased victim. He also confirmed that the conglomerate will bear the complete medical costs of the injured and ensure proper treatment and support. Furthermore, the Tata Group will fund the construction of a new hostel at BJ Medical College, where several students lost their lives in the crash.

Home Minister Visits Injured Victims at Trauma Centre

Union Home Minister Amit Shah visited the Trauma Centre at Ahmedabad Civil Hospital, where many of the injured are being treated. During his visit, he reviewed emergency medical arrangements and interacted with healthcare staff and officials involved in relief operations.
